You've probably felt all of these. We've seen them across dozens of EPC and engineering projects.
Lives in emails, WhatsApp, Excel, and project tools
Project information scattered across multiple systems. Nobody has a single source of truth. Documentation gets duplicated or lost. Critical information disappears between office, site, and vendors.
Site, office, vendors, subcontractors, clients in different systems
Site teams report to office teams who coordinate with vendors. Approvals require hunting signatures across multiple channels. The more stakeholders involved, the more coordination breaks down.
Approval delays kill schedules. Manual reporting takes hours daily.
Nobody has real-time visibility into what's actually happening on site. By the time problems surface, delays have already cascaded into other work streams. Manual reporting consumes time that should go to project management.

We spend 7–10 days mapping how work currently moves through your organization. We document information flows, identify where communication breaks down, quantify manual work, and surface approval delays. We deliver workflow maps, a bottleneck analysis, risk assessment, and prioritized recommendations for improvement. Price: $1,000–$1,500.
You'll have a clear picture of your operational bottlenecks and which improvements create the most business value. If you want to move forward, we offer two next steps: Process & Documentation Improvement (redesign workflows, create standards, $750–$1,000) or Workflow Implementation (build and deploy solutions, $2,000–$5,000+). Or you can implement recommendations on your own. No pressure, no lock-in.
It depends on what you're improving. Documentation and communication protocol changes can be done in 2–3 weeks. Workflow automation or system integrations typically take 3–6 weeks. We work alongside your team, so timelines account for your schedule and resource availability.
